5
h-index
5
Publications
13,654
Citations

Researcher Info

h-index
5
Publications
5
Citations
13,654
Institution
Massachusetts Institute of Technology

Identifiers

ORCID
0000-0002-2540-7099

Impact Metrics

h-index 5

h-index: Number of publications with at least h citations each.